About Strategic Mind: Blitzkrieg

The game is created with great care and attention to historical details by a team that is passionate about WW2 history. The cinematics before and after every operation add depth and immersion into the events unfolding before your eyes. Moreover, a number of primary and secondary objectives allow you to explore every scenario in detail. The gameplay is plot-driven and features many historical personalities such as Franz Halder, Heinz Guderian, Erich von Manstein, Erwin Rommel, Karl Dönitz, Wilhelm Canaris, Hermann Göring, and others.

Strategic Mind: Blitzkrieg is the second installment in the Strategic Mind line of games. While “The Pacific” was more about naval warfare, the “Blitzkrieg” brings us all into the continental battles fought by the German troops. As a part of the Strategic Mind franchise, it will retain many features of the series along with adding new content and features to the existing variety.

- You will have the opportunity to command ground, air, and naval forces with the emphasis on the land battles.
- Modern 3D graphics brought by UE4 engine with detailed models of all the units, day/night cycle, and weather effects.
- You can upgrade and customize your troops by leveling them up and selecting skills that best suit your strategy. Moreover, you can equip your troops with additional equipment for each operation to better suit both your strategy and the war theatre.
- You will gain a number of awards throughout the game and get access to unique HQ skills, which you can learn to increase the efficiency and synergy of your troops.
- You can acquire new units of various types, or upgrade your existing ones. All new units and equipment are available at historically accurate moments of the campaign.
- You can take numerous trophies and use some of the enemy`s most advanced units against him in future battles.
- While we strive for historical accuracy, we also allow you to explore various “what if’s” and see what could have happened should the German Armed forces be even more successful in their struggle for dominance over the European continent.
- Storytelling cinematics, as well as in-operation dialogues with full voice over, will help you get a better feeling of the epochal events.

I first started playing this game in 2020 on a pirated version. 6 years, it took me 6 YEARS to finally beat this game. Now normally any game that would have taken me this long to actually pull myself together and finish it I would have dropped it and forgot about, but this one... something made me come back again and again. The final missions in the soviet union are insane. ♥♥♥♥ hits the fan after Crete and cranks up to 11 when Barbarossa kicks in. YOU HAVE TO KILL THE ENTIRE POPULATION OF THE SOVIET UNION TO EVEN HAVE A CHANCE. This game is what your hoi4 generals have to deal with when you draw that arrow. You can't have casualties in this game. You are fighting against an invisible clock of your army becoming redundant and your snowball offensive against the world WIILL grind to a halt if you continue to make mistakes. In the context of the third reich's economy being dependent on pillaging and plunder I guess it's kinda realistic. For context everything in this game costs on Prestige, you get it after killing enemies and completing missions.
